Routine attention
- Daily
- Confirm the control equipment shows normal operation or that displayed faults are being handled.
- Weekly
- Operate a different manual call point and confirm the expected response.
- Periodic
- A competent person inspects and tests a proportion of the system at intervals no longer than the stated maximum.
- Across 12 months
- The programme should cover every device and the system as a whole.
Record tests, alarms, faults and work in the system logbook. Non-routine attention is also needed after a fire or when false-alarm performance is unacceptable.
